class TFBertPreTrainingLoss:
    """
    Loss function suitable for BERT-like pretraining, that is, the task of pretraining a language model by combining
    NSP + MLM. .. note:: Any label of -100 will be ignored (along with the corresponding logits) in the loss
    computation.
    """

    def compute_loss(self, labels: tf.Tensor, logits: tf.Tensor) -> tf.Tensor:
        loss_fn = tf.keras.losses.SparseCategoricalCrossentropy(
            from_logits=True, reduction=tf.keras.losses.Reduction.NONE
        )
        # make sure only labels that are not equal to -100
        # are taken into account as loss
        masked_lm_active_loss = tf.not_equal(tf.reshape(tensor=labels["labels"], shape=(-1,)), -100)
        masked_lm_reduced_logits = tf.boolean_mask(
            tensor=tf.reshape(tensor=logits[0], shape=(-1, shape_list(logits[0])[2])),
            mask=masked_lm_active_loss,
        )
        masked_lm_labels = tf.boolean_mask(
            tensor=tf.reshape(tensor=labels["labels"], shape=(-1,)), mask=masked_lm_active_loss
        )
        next_sentence_active_loss = tf.not_equal(tf.reshape(tensor=labels["next_sentence_label"], shape=(-1,)), -100)
        next_sentence_reduced_logits = tf.boolean_mask(
            tensor=tf.reshape(tensor=logits[1], shape=(-1, 2)), mask=next_sentence_active_loss
        )
        next_sentence_label = tf.boolean_mask(
            tensor=tf.reshape(tensor=labels["next_sentence_label"], shape=(-1,)), mask=next_sentence_active_loss
        )
        masked_lm_loss = loss_fn(y_true=masked_lm_labels, y_pred=masked_lm_reduced_logits)
        next_sentence_loss = loss_fn(y_true=next_sentence_label, y_pred=next_sentence_reduced_logits)
        masked_lm_loss = tf.reshape(tensor=masked_lm_loss, shape=(-1, shape_list(next_sentence_loss)[0]))
        masked_lm_loss = tf.reduce_mean(input_tensor=masked_lm_loss, axis=0)

        return masked_lm_loss + next_sentence_loss


class TFBertEmbeddings(tf.keras.layers.Layer):
    """Construct the embeddings from word, position and token_type embeddings."""

    def __init__(self, config: BertConfig, **kwargs):
        super().__init__(**kwargs)

        self.vocab_size = config.vocab_size
        self.type_vocab_size = config.type_vocab_size
        self.hidden_size = config.hidden_size
        self.max_position_embeddings = config.max_position_embeddings
        self.initializer_range = config.initializer_range
        self.LayerNorm = tf.keras.layers.LayerNormalization(epsilon=config.layer_norm_eps, name="LayerNorm")
        self.dropout = tf.keras.layers.Dropout(rate=config.hidden_dropout_prob)

    def build(self, input_shape: tf.TensorShape):
        with tf.name_scope("word_embeddings"):
            self.weight = self.add_weight(
                name="weight",
                shape=[self.vocab_size, self.hidden_size],
                initializer=get_initializer(self.initializer_range),
            )

        with tf.name_scope("token_type_embeddings"):
            self.token_type_embeddings = self.add_weight(
                name="embeddings",
                shape=[self.type_vocab_size, self.hidden_size],
                initializer=get_initializer(self.initializer_range),
            )

        with tf.name_scope("position_embeddings"):
            self.position_embeddings = self.add_weight(
                name="embeddings",
                shape=[self.max_position_embeddings, self.hidden_size],
                initializer=get_initializer(self.initializer_range),
            )

        super().build(input_shape)

    def call(
        self,
        input_ids: tf.Tensor = None,
        position_ids: tf.Tensor = None,
        token_type_ids: tf.Tensor = None,
        inputs_embeds: tf.Tensor = None,
        past_key_values_length=0,
        training: bool = False,
    ) -> tf.Tensor:
        """
        Applies embedding based on inputs tensor.

        Returns:
            final_embeddings (`tf.Tensor`): output embedding tensor.
        """
        if input_ids is None and inputs_embeds is None:
            raise ValueError("Need to provide either `input_ids` or `input_embeds`.")

        if input_ids is not None:
            inputs_embeds = tf.gather(params=self.weight, indices=input_ids)

        input_shape = shape_list(inputs_embeds)[:-1]

        if token_type_ids is None:
            token_type_ids = tf.fill(dims=input_shape, value=0)

        if position_ids is None:
            position_ids = tf.expand_dims(
                tf.range(start=past_key_values_length, limit=input_shape[1] + past_key_values_length), axis=0
            )

        position_embeds = tf.gather(params=self.position_embeddings, indices=position_ids)
        token_type_embeds = tf.gather(params=self.token_type_embeddings, indices=token_type_ids)
        final_embeddings = inputs_embeds + position_embeds + token_type_embeds
        final_embeddings = self.LayerNorm(inputs=final_embeddings)
        final_embeddings = self.dropout(inputs=final_embeddings, training=training)

        return final_embeddings


class TFBertSelfAttention(tf.keras.layers.Layer):
    def __init__(self, config: BertConfig, **kwargs):
        super().__init__(**kwargs)

        if config.hidden_size % config.num_attention_heads != 0:
            raise ValueError(
                f"The hidden size ({config.hidden_size}) is not a multiple of the number "
                f"of attention heads ({config.num_attention_heads})"
            )

        self.num_attention_heads = config.num_attention_heads
        self.attention_head_size = int(config.hidden_size / config.num_attention_heads)
        self.all_head_size = self.num_attention_heads * self.attention_head_size
        self.sqrt_att_head_size = math.sqrt(self.attention_head_size)

        self.query = tf.keras.layers.Dense(
            units=self.all_head_size, kernel_initializer=get_initializer(config.initializer_range), name="query"
        )
        self.key = tf.keras.layers.Dense(
            units=self.all_head_size, kernel_initializer=get_initializer(config.initializer_range), name="key"
        )
        self.value = tf.keras.layers.Dense(
            units=self.all_head_size, kernel_initializer=get_initializer(config.initializer_range), name="value"
        )
        self.dropout = tf.keras.layers.Dropout(rate=config.attention_probs_dropout_prob)

        self.is_decoder = config.is_decoder

    def transpose_for_scores(self, tensor: tf.Tensor, batch_size: int) -> tf.Tensor:
        # Reshape from [batch_size, seq_length, all_head_size] to [batch_size, seq_length, num_attention_heads, attention_head_size]
        tensor = tf.reshape(tensor=tensor, shape=(batch_size, -1, self.num_attention_heads, self.attention_head_size))

        # Transpose the tensor from [batch_size, seq_length, num_attention_heads, attention_head_size] to [batch_size, num_attention_heads, seq_length, attention_head_size]
        return tf.transpose(tensor, perm=[0, 2, 1, 3])

    def call(
        self,
        hidden_states: tf.Tensor,
        attention_mask: tf.Tensor,
        head_mask: tf.Tensor,
        encoder_hidden_states: tf.Tensor,
        encoder_attention_mask: tf.Tensor,
        past_key_value: Tuple[tf.Tensor],
        output_attentions: bool,
        training: bool = False,
    ) -> Tuple[tf.Tensor]:
        batch_size = shape_list(hidden_states)[0]
        mixed_query_layer = self.query(inputs=hidden_states)

        # If this is instantiated as a cross-attention module, the keys
        # and values come from an encoder; the attention mask needs to be
        # such that the encoder's padding tokens are not attended to.
        is_cross_attention = encoder_hidden_states is not None

        if is_cross_attention and past_key_value is not None:
            # reuse k,v, cross_attentions
            key_layer = past_key_value[0]
            value_layer = past_key_value[1]
            attention_mask = encoder_attention_mask
        elif is_cross_attention:
            key_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(self.key(inputs=encoder_hidden_states), batch_size)
            value_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(self.value(inputs=encoder_hidden_states), batch_size)
            attention_mask = encoder_attention_mask
        elif past_key_value is not None:
            key_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(self.key(inputs=hidden_states), batch_size)
            value_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(self.value(inputs=hidden_states), batch_size)
            key_layer = tf.concatenate([past_key_value[0], key_layer], dim=2)
            value_layer = tf.concatenate([past_key_value[1], value_layer], dim=2)
        else:
            key_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(self.key(inputs=hidden_states), batch_size)
            value_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(self.value(inputs=hidden_states), batch_size)

        query_layer = self.transpose_for_scores(mixed_query_layer, batch_size)

        if self.is_decoder:
            # if cross_attention save Tuple(tf.Tensor, tf.Tensor) of all cross attention key/value_states.
            # Further calls to cross_attention layer can then reuse all cross-attention
            # key/value_states (first "if" case)
            # if uni-directional self-attention (decoder) save Tuple(tf.Tensor, tf.Tensor) of
            # all previous decoder key/value_states. Further calls to uni-directional self-attention
            # can concat previous decoder key/value_states to current projected key/value_states (third "elif" case)
            # if encoder bi-directional self-attention `past_key_value` is always `None`
            past_key_value = (key_layer, value_layer)

        # Take the dot product between "query" and "key" to get the raw attention scores.
        # (batch size, num_heads, seq_len_q, seq_len_k)
        attention_scores = tf.matmul(query_layer, key_layer, transpose_b=True)
        dk = tf.cast(self.sqrt_att_head_size, dtype=attention_scores.dtype)
        attention_scores = tf.divide(attention_scores, dk)

        if attention_mask is not None:
            # Apply the attention mask is (precomputed for all layers in TFBertModel call() function)
            attention_scores = tf.add(attention_scores, attention_mask)

        # Normalize the attention scores to probabilities.
        attention_probs = tf.nn.softmax(logits=attention_scores, axis=-1)

        # This is actually dropping out entire tokens to attend to, which might
        # seem a bit unusual, but is taken from the original Transformer paper.
        attention_probs = self.dropout(inputs=attention_probs, training=training)

        # Mask heads if we want to
        if head_mask is not None:
            attention_probs = tf.multiply(attention_probs, head_mask)

        attention_output = tf.matmul(attention_probs, value_layer)
        attention_output = tf.transpose(attention_output, perm=[0, 2, 1, 3])

        # (batch_size, seq_len_q, all_head_size)
        attention_output = tf.reshape(tensor=attention_output, shape=(batch_size, -1, self.all_head_size))
        outputs = (attention_output, attention_probs) if output_attentions else (attention_output,)

        if self.is_decoder:
            outputs = outputs + (past_key_value,)
        return outputs

BERT_START_DOCSTRING = r"""

    This model inherits from [`TFPreTrainedModel`]. Check the superclass documentation for the
    generic methods the library implements for all its model (such as downloading or saving, resizing the input
    embeddings, pruning heads etc.)

    This model is also a [tf.keras.Model](https://www.tensorflow.org/api_docs/python/tf/keras/Model) subclass. Use
    it as a regular TF 2.0 Keras Model and refer to the TF 2.0 documentation for all matter related to general usage
    and behavior.

    <Tip>

    TF 2.0 models accepts two formats as inputs:

    - having all inputs as keyword arguments (like PyTorch models), or
    - having all inputs as a list, tuple or dict in the first positional arguments.

    This second option is useful when using [`tf.keras.Model.fit`] method which currently requires having all
    the tensors in the first argument of the model call function: `model(inputs)`.

    If you choose this second option, there are three possibilities you can use to gather all the input Tensors in
    the first positional argument :

    - a single Tensor with `input_ids` only and nothing else: `model(inputs_ids)`
    - a list of varying length with one or several input Tensors IN THE ORDER given in the docstring:
    `model([input_ids, attention_mask])` or `model([input_ids, attention_mask, token_type_ids])`
    - a dictionary with one or several input Tensors associated to the input names given in the docstring:
    `model({"input_ids": input_ids, "token_type_ids": token_type_ids})`

    </Tip>

    Args:
        config ([`BertConfig`]): Model configuration class with all the parameters of the model.
            Initializing with a config file does not load the weights associated with the model, only the
            configuration. Check out the [`~TFPreTrainedModel.from_pretrained`] method to load the
            model weights.
"""

BERT_INPUTS_DOCSTRING = r"""
    Args:
        input_ids (`np.ndarray`, `tf.Tensor`, `List[tf.Tensor]` ``Dict[str, tf.Tensor]` or `Dict[str, np.ndarray]` and each example must have the shape `({0})`):
            Indices of input sequence tokens in the vocabulary.

            Indices can be obtained using [`BertTokenizer`]. See
            [`PreTrainedTokenizer.__call__`] and [`PreTrainedTokenizer.encode`] for
            details.

            [What are input IDs?](../glossary#input-ids)
        attention_mask (`np.ndarray` or `tf.Tensor` of shape `({0})`, *optional*):
            Mask to avoid performing attention on padding token indices. Mask values selected in `[0, 1]`:

            - 1 for tokens that are **not masked**,
            - 0 for tokens that are **masked**.

            [What are attention masks?](../glossary#attention-mask)
        token_type_ids (`np.ndarray` or `tf.Tensor` of shape `({0})`, *optional*):
            Segment token indices to indicate first and second portions of the inputs. Indices are selected in `[0, 1]`:

            - 0 corresponds to a *sentence A* token,
            - 1 corresponds to a *sentence B* token.

            [What are token type IDs?](../glossary#token-type-ids)
        position_ids (`np.ndarray` or `tf.Tensor` of shape `({0})`, *optional*):
            Indices of positions of each input sequence tokens in the position embeddings. Selected in the range `[0, config.max_position_embeddings - 1]`.

            [What are position IDs?](../glossary#position-ids)
        head_mask (`np.ndarray` or `tf.Tensor` of shape `(num_heads,)` or `(num_layers, num_heads)`, *optional*):
            Mask to nullify selected heads of the self-attention modules. Mask values selected in `[0, 1]`:

            - 1 indicates the head is **not masked**,
            - 0 indicates the head is **masked**.

        inputs_embeds (`np.ndarray` or `tf.Tensor` of shape `({0}, hidden_size)`, *optional*):
            Optionally, instead of passing `input_ids` you can choose to directly pass an embedded representation.
            This is useful if you want more control over how to convert `input_ids` indices into associated
            vectors than the model's internal embedding lookup matrix.
        output_attentions (`bool`, *optional*):
            Whether or not to return the attentions tensors of all attention layers. See `attentions` under returned
            tensors for more detail. This argument can be used only in eager mode, in graph mode the value in the
            config will be used instead.
        output_hidden_states (`bool`, *optional*):
            Whether or not to return the hidden states of all layers. See `hidden_states` under returned tensors for
            more detail. This argument can be used only in eager mode, in graph mode the value in the config will be
            used instead.
        return_dict (`bool`, *optional*):
            Whether or not to return a [`~file_utils.ModelOutput`] instead of a plain tuple. This
            argument can be used in eager mode, in graph mode the value will always be set to True.
        training (`bool`, *optional*, defaults to `False``):
            Whether or not to use the model in training mode (some modules like dropout modules have different
            behaviors between training and evaluation).
"""
